You can create promotional codes to offer discounts to your audience.
Codes can be:
A fixed amount off (example: $10 off)
A percentage discount (example: 60% off)
DNNR keeps a minimum take rate of $4.80 per ticket.
You can also choose whether the code:
Works for unlimited uses
Or expires after a specific number of redemptions across all customers

📍 Location
Choose a downtown district with at least 7–10 moderately priced restaurants and a large bar for the after party.
We’ll send groups of six to different restaurants — usually 1–3 tables per restaurant, depending on your group size and restaurant availability.

Each questionnaire question can use a different scoring method depending on the type of groups you want to create.
These are optimization preferences for the algorithm — not strict guarantees. If it’s possible to satisfy them while balancing the rest of the dinner, the algorithm usually will.
Same
Group people who answered similarly.
Use this when you want people seated with others who selected the same answer.

To create the best possible experience, dinner clubs require a minimum of 30 attendees per location before they can move forward.
Larger groups lead to:
Better personality matches
Stronger table dynamics
Better restaurant experiences
More successful afterparties
Higher attendee satisfaction overall
